OGIO EVP Harlan Gardiner announced the appointment of Luke Edgar to the newly created position of director of sales/Packs and Duffels Division. Edgar, who most recently served Atomic Snowboarding USA as its director of sales and general manager, is renowned for his vision, management expertise, and personal relationship with the action sports market.

“Luke’s personality, his drive, and his enthusiasm for our market just screams OGIO,” Gardiner says. “He’s the kind of guy whose passion for the brand will be contagious among our reps, and with our customers. Luke’s ready to take his experience to a broader platform, and we’re real excited to have him on board.”

Edgar will report to Harlan Gardiner. Ken Tincher, OGIO’s sales manager for packs and duffels, will report to Edgar and continue to manage key account sales.

Edgar started snowboarding and competing in the 80’s and was a regional rider for K2. In 1992, he subsequently was recruited to an in-house sales position and worked his way up the ranks until being appointed sales and brand manager in 1998. Four years later, he joined Atomic Snowboards USA to oversee worldwide branding, marketing and product distribution. In just two years, he helped grow the company’s product offerings more than 20 times and distribution points by nearly 200 percent.
